Yes, candidates can withdraw their MCA fees from Dayananda Sagar College of Engineering after the commencement of classes. However, there are certain terms and conditions applied by the college on withdrawal. Check out the conditions below:
| Time of Withdrawl | Fee Refunded |
|---|---|
| Any time after admission but before the date of commencement of classes. | Total fees after deducting INR 10,000 |
| Within fifteen days from the date of commencement of classes | 50% of the total fee |
| After fifteen days, from the date of commencement of classes | No refund, required to pay the remaining years' tuition fee |
Candidates must note that, decision of the college is final on all the matters related to fee/ refunds. Policies and regulations subject to revision from time to time.

The SIMMC MCA fee structure consists of various components, which are one-time chargeable or have to be paid annually/semester-wise. Some of the fee components are tuition fee, security deposit, hostel fee, etc. Table below showcases the PG course fee details:
Fee components | Amount (2 years) |
|---|---|
Tuition fees | INR 1.50 Lakh |
Hostel fees | INR 1.20 Lakh |
NOTE: The aforementioned fee is as per the official website/sanctioning body. It is still subject to changes and hence, is indicative.

MET Institute of Computer Science provides MCA programme at the PG level. The total fees for the programme is around INR 3.48 Lacs. Admission to the programme is based on an entrance exam. Candidates will be shortlisted based on their CET scores. Interested candidates can fill out the application form on the official website.
